goblinAmerica changes
Look:
Added a graphics setting to enable hardware raytracing for Lumen. This should improve and stabilize global illumination for GPUs that support it. If your GPU does not support it, it will not do anything.
Made some changes to how skeletal meshes (like NPCs) are handled, which should improve performance in areas with lots of guys running around.
Because of the above two changes, you might have to recompile some shaders the next time you play. That's normal.
Changed how the nexus engine permutates when observing greater-than-delta oscillations. This should drastically reduce hitching when loading/unloading some zones on the Ford's Theatre and Pan-American Exposition levels.
Added a setting to disable your crosshair for some reason.
Fixed a bug.
Restarting the level from the pause menu (either via the restart button or the change-loadout screen) should be generally less weird.
